Use whipped cream and ping pong balls to create “eggs” to play with. practice whipping and flipping with play kitchen toys, pretend to cook them in play kitchen pans, and serve them on play plates. Egg shape matching for extra fun. Discuss the life cycle of a chicken & fertilization, the parts of an egg (shell & pores, albumen, yolk, air sac), or ways to order your eggs. Make your own whipped cream as a bonus and serve eggs for lunch that day!
